One of my leading Clients in BS16 is looking for a secretary / Administrator to join their busy team:

9am- 5pm and you can work from home Tues, Weds and Thurs!

Your key responsibilities will include:-•    Coordinating the preparation and filing of statutory forms at Companies House and other administrative tasks required to ensure clients meet their statutory and regulatory compliance obligations.•    Independently managing filing deadlines for a large portfolio of clients.•    Assisting management with ad hoc projects and the onboarding of new clients.•    Maintaining and updating client reports and systems, to record work completed.•    Providing administrative support to members of the company secretarial team.•    Answering calls from clients•    Ad hoc duties as required

Full training will be provided.The job is a full-time role based on a 35 hour week and is offered with the flexibility of both office and remote working.First Corporate can offer a range of generous benefits, which include: -

•    Salary of £24k - £26k per annum

•    21 days annual leave (plus bank holidays) - increasing by one day for each completed year of service (capped at 30 days)•    Private healthcare (available on the successful completion probationary period)

Work from home 3 days per week•    Enrolment into the company’s pension scheme
